时滞差分系统依照两种测度的稳定性  

Stability Analysis in Terms of Two Measures for Delay Difference Systems

摘  要:运用变异李亚谱诺夫方法 ,讨论了时滞差分系统依照两种测度的稳定性 .借助于中间测度h* (n,x) ,建立了由常差分系统两种测度稳定性而推出时滞差分系统相应的两种测度稳定性的判别准则 .作为特例 ,给出了易于检验的比较原理 ,并用算例说明所得结果之应用 .Employing the so called variational Liapunov method, this article discussed the stability properties of delay difference systems in terms of two measures. Utilizing the auxiliary measure h *(n,x) , it established several criteria in which the stability properties in terms of two measures for ordinary difference system imply the corresponding stability properties in terms of two measures for the relevant delay difference system. As a special case, an easy to check comparison theorem was derived. Moreover, some examples were given to illustrate the applications of the obtained results.
